So my questions are, I'm assuming this second point regarding "limits on time allowed to edit..." posts applies to all posters including those who have been members for over a year even.Moonchild wrote:Unfortunately, as Pale Moon's popularity grows, so does the attempted spamming of the forum. I've had to put more spam protection measures in place, although this shouldn't impact most users.
In effect now:
- New: Newly registered users will have their first 1 or 2 posts moderated before being given normal access
- Limits on time allowed to edit or delete your own posts
- Captchas (annoying, but effective)
- New: Checking upon registration of known spammer details @stopforumspam - and refusal to admit people with matching credentials (you misbehave on any other forum using that service, and you will be banned here too)
- Alert and aware fellow users who report spam posts and suspicious activity (thanks guys&girls!)

Re: Edit button missing, unable to edit posts!
Editing is limited to 2 hours after another recent spat of destructive behavior by users.
I'm not inclined to change it again, because it's apparently very much needed. 2 hours should be sufficient for any casual editing needed of new posts (and if you feel you need to do more, then save the post as a draft before you actually post it, and go back as often as you like before finally putting it on the forum) while not being so long that edits would disrupt conversations that are ongoing on the topic. You are free to add follow-ups to posts to clarify.
